Output 4fab143700b85764ebaf18c924a44b657ce64c23f1e24c18329663bdae098c75:2

value
26220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13808dacd27cb73db7e9a421b56a3bc63e4b347f OP_EQUAL
address
33U8mEgG4NyLDwV6kiGrdGWWxNcchztnQ8
transaction
4fab143700b85764ebaf18c924a44b657ce64c23f1e24c18329663bdae098c75
spent
true